mirror of
https://github.com/asterisk/asterisk.git
synced 2025-10-26 06:26:41 +00:00
This change adds the required logic to allow the SIP Call-ID to be placed into the HEP RTCP traffic if the chan_sip module is used. In cases where the option is enabled but the channel is not either SIP or PJSIP then the code will fallback to the channel name as done previously. Based on the change on Nir's branch at: team/nirs/hep-chan-sip-support ASTERISK-26427 Change-Id: I09ffa5f6e2fdfd99ee999650ba4e0a7aad6dc40d
33 lines
1.8 KiB
Plaintext
33 lines
1.8 KiB
Plaintext
;
|
|
; res_hep Module configuration for Asterisk
|
|
;
|
|
|
|
;
|
|
; Note that this configuration file is consumed by res_hep, which is responsible
|
|
; for the HEPv3 protocol manipulation and managing the connection to the Homer
|
|
; capture server. Additional modules provide specific messages to be sent to
|
|
; the Homer server:
|
|
; - res_hep_pjsip: Send SIP messages transmitted/received by the PJSIP stack
|
|
; - res_hep_rtcp: Send RTCP information (all channels)
|
|
;
|
|
|
|
; All settings are currently set in the general section.
|
|
[general]
|
|
enabled = no ; Enable/disable forwarding of packets to a
|
|
; HEP server. Default is "yes".
|
|
capture_address = 192.168.1.1:9061 ; The address of the HEP capture server.
|
|
capture_password = foo ; If specified, the authorization passsword
|
|
; for the HEP server. If not specified, no
|
|
; authorization password will be sent.
|
|
capture_id = 1234 ; A unique integer identifier for this
|
|
; server. This ID will be embedded sent
|
|
; with each packet from this server.
|
|
uuid_type = call-id ; Specify the preferred source for the Homer
|
|
; correlation UUID. Valid options are:
|
|
; - 'call-id' for the PJSIP or chan_sip SIP
|
|
; Call-ID
|
|
; - 'channel' for the Asterisk channel name
|
|
; Note: If 'call-id' is specified but the
|
|
; channel is not PJSIP or chan_sip then the
|
|
; Asterisk channel name will be used instead.
|